Metabolite results when a drug is metabolized into a modified form which continues to produce effects. Endogenous variables like age, sex, body composition, genetics, and underlying pathologies have an impact on a given body fluid's metabolome. The activity of an enormous variety of enzymes and transporters responsible for the production, transformation, degradation, and compartmentalization of these small molecules typically keeps the levels of the enormous variety of unique small-molecule metabolites tightly regulated. In the brain, endogenous small molecules are typically present at levels that are tightly controlled.
